CDEFINES =
CWARNINGS =
+BACKTRACECFLAGS = @BACKTRACECFLAGS@
DNSLIBS = ../../lib/dns/libdns.@A@ @DNS_CRYPTO_LIBS@
ISCLIBS = ../../lib/isc/libisc.@A@ @DNS_CRYPTO_LIBS@
@BIND9_MAKE_RULES@
# disable optimization for backtrace test to get the expected result
-BTTEST_CFLAGS = ${EXT_CFLAGS} ${ALL_CPPFLAGS} -g ${ALWAYS_WARNINGS} \
- ${STD_CWARNINGS} ${CWARNINGS}
+BTTEST_CFLAGS = ${BACKTRACECFLAGS} ${EXT_CFLAGS} ${ALL_CPPFLAGS} -g \
+ ${ALWAYS_WARNINGS} ${STD_CWARNINGS} ${CWARNINGS}
all_tests: ${XTARGETS}
ETAGS
LN
ARFLAGS
+BACKTRACECFLAGS
CCNOOPT
CCOPT
STD_CWARNINGS
+
# Warn if the user specified libbind, which is now deprecated
# Check whether --enable-libbind was given.
if test "${enable_libbind+set}" = set; then :
fi
case "$host" in
*-hp-hpux*)
- STD_CWARNINGS="$STD_CWARNINGS -Wl,+vnocompatwarnings"
+ CFLAGS="$CFLAGS -Wl,+vnocompatwarnings"
+ BACKTRACECFLAGS="$BACKTRACECFLAGS -Wl,+vnocompatwarnings"
;;
esac
else
esac
CCOPT="$CCOPT -Ae -z"
CCNOOPT="$CCNOOPT -Ae -z"
- STD_CWARNINGS="$STD_CWARNINGS -Wl,+vnocompatwarnings"
+ CFLAGS="$CFLAGS -Wl,+vnocompatwarnings"
+ BACKTRACECFLAGS="$BACKTRACECFLAGS -Wl,+vnocompatwarnings"
MKDEPPROG='cc -Ae -E -Wp,-M >/dev/null 2>>$TMP'
;;
*-sgi-irix*)
AC_SUBST(STD_CWARNINGS)
AC_SUBST(CCOPT)
AC_SUBST(CCNOOPT)
+AC_SUBST(BACKTRACECFLAGS)
# Warn if the user specified libbind, which is now deprecated
AC_ARG_ENABLE(libbind, [ --enable-libbind deprecated])
fi
case "$host" in
*-hp-hpux*)
- STD_CWARNINGS="$STD_CWARNINGS -Wl,+vnocompatwarnings"
+ CFLAGS="$CFLAGS -Wl,+vnocompatwarnings"
+ BACKTRACECFLAGS="$BACKTRACECFLAGS -Wl,+vnocompatwarnings"
;;
esac
else
esac
CCOPT="$CCOPT -Ae -z"
CCNOOPT="$CCNOOPT -Ae -z"
- STD_CWARNINGS="$STD_CWARNINGS -Wl,+vnocompatwarnings"
+ CFLAGS="$CFLAGS -Wl,+vnocompatwarnings"
+ BACKTRACECFLAGS="$BACKTRACECFLAGS -Wl,+vnocompatwarnings"
MKDEPPROG='cc -Ae -E -Wp,-M >/dev/null 2>>$TMP'
;;
*-sgi-irix*)